About Strand
Strand is a prominent thoroughfare located in Greater London, England, within the WC2N postcode area. It runs parallel to the River Thames and connects the City of London with the West End. The street is lined with a variety of shops, restaurants, and cultural institutions, making it a busy area for both locals and visitors. Notable landmarks along Strand include the Royal Courts of Justice and the historic Somerset House, which hosts art exhibitions and events throughout the year. The area is well-served by public transport, with several bus routes and nearby underground stations, providing easy access to other parts of London. Strand is also close to the famous Covent Garden and the vibrant theatre district, making it a convenient location for those looking to explore the city's cultural offerings.
